Interior Design and Interior Decoration

Vestavia Hills Alabama interior designed living room with piano

Often people mistake interior design for interior decoration and vice versa. The primary difference between the two is the level of education required. Anyone can do business as an interior decorator if they have a general knowledge of or a skill for decorating interior areas. However, working as an interior designer necessitates formal training and in numerous states one must have an accredited Associate or Bachelor's Degree as well as be licensed. Interior designers are educated to make work or living spaces functional as well as attractive. On many projects they may team up with building engineers and architects. There are 2 general categories that an interior designer in Vestavia Hills AL may specialize in:

  • Residential Design. Interior Designers frequently work on new construction and existing homes. They can design basically any room of the home, including bedrooms, basements and closets. Or they may specialize in designing one specific room, for example bathrooms or kitchens.
  • Commercial Designing. When working on public or commercial areas, designers often concentrate predominantly on either functionality or aesthetic appeal but take notice of both. For instance, business meeting rooms and reception areas are spaces where aesthetics may be emphasized over function. Designs for banks and hospitals might concentrate more on functionality over appearance as the main concern.

There are various areas of commercial and residential interior design that a designer needs to learn, for example lighting, color schemes, furniture and acoustics. They have to be able to use graphic design and read blue prints in order to create their visions. From selecting wall paper and carpeting to integrating Feng shui concepts, Vestavia Hills AL interior designers employ a wide range of skills that help bring about their final designs.

Interior Design Degree Options

Vestavia Hills Alabama spacious interior designed kitchen with hanging lights

There are four degree alternatives offered in interior design to obtain the training necessary to start your new career in Vestavia Hills AL. Your selection will no doubt be influenced by your career objectives as well as the time and money that you have to commit to your education. But regardless of which degree program you opt to enroll in, be sure to pick one that is accredited. Accreditation is needed in order to take the National Council for Interior Design Qualification (NCIDQ) exam required in several states. More will be addressed on additional benefits of accreditation later. Below are brief descriptions of the interior design degrees that are offered.

  • Associate Degree. Associate degrees in interior design furnish the minimum amount of training needed to enter the profession. They take approximately 2 years to finish and programs are offered at numerous Alabama trade schools and junior colleges. Graduates can usually obtain entry level jobs as design assistants.
  • Bachelor's Degree. Bachelor's degrees are four year programs that supply more extensive training than the Associate Degree. They cover the technical and creative aspects of the trade needed to become a designer. They are the minimum credential needed by a college graduate in order to secure an entry level position as an interior designer.
  • Master's Degree. These two year programs provide advanced training in design after acquiring the Bachelor's Degree. Master's Degrees provide alternatives in specialized majors in general areas such as business offices or residential bathrooms. A number of students enroll to advance their skills to be more competitive in the job market.
  • Doctorate Degree. Doctorate degrees are mainly for those professionals who desire to teach interior design at a university or college level. The programs differ in length but are normally completed in 3 to 5 years.

In order to work professionally and adopt the title of "Interior Designer", a number of states mandate that graduates of accredited schools become licensed. In several instances, 2 or more years of professional experience may be required before an applicant can sit for the licensing examination.

Is the Interior Designer Degree Program Accredited? It's important to confirm that the interior design program and college that you select has been accredited by either a regional or national organization. One of the most respected in the field is the National Association of Schools of Art and Design (NASAD). Schools earning accreditation from the NASAD have undergone a demanding evaluation of their teachers and programs. Just confirm that both the college and the degree program have been acc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ting organization. Not only will it help establish that the reputation of the college and the quality of the training are outstanding, it may also help when securing financial aid or a student loan. Often they are not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Also, a number of Vestavia Hills AL employers will only employ graduates of accredited programs for entry level positions.

Does the School Prepare you for Licensing? As we mentioned earlier, a number of States do mandate that interior designers get licensed. This would require a passing score on the National Council for Interior Design Qualification (NCIDQ) examination as well as a degree from an accredited college. And in several of those States mandating licensing, at least 2 years of work experience may be required also. So besides providing an outstanding education, the Vestavia Hills AL program you choose should also provide the appropriate education to pass the NCIDQ examination and satisfy the minimum requirements for licensing for Alabama or the State where you will be working.
